Meat Loaf + orchestra should be a match made in heaven. If ever anyone wrote songs that should translate to an orchestral setting, it's Jim Steinman.
I suspect that the reality falls far short of the dream, however. If Meat's in the same vocal form as he was in January, then I dread to think what this sounds like.
Classic Rock magazine have given it a 2-star review this issue.
